Hattaren
Character of the water
Hattaren lies in the south — a southern humic brown tarn. The tea-stained, humic water hides the bottom within an arm's length.
The surroundings
The lake lies half-remote, a fair way from the nearest road, tucked into woodland.
Moderately deep (5 m) — shallow bays, the odd reef and a deeper channel through the middle.
Permits & rules
Fishing permit required — Hattaren FVOF. Day permit ~140 kr · annual permit ~700 kr.
- Zander: minimum size 45 cm · protected during the spawn (Apr–May).
- Pike: keep at most one over 75 cm per day.
- Handheld tackle only. Respect the protected zones at the inlets and outlets.
Species in Hattaren
Fishing Hattaren
Hattaren holds 4 species, with perch, pike and zander at the top of the chain and roach schooling beneath them. The modest depth keeps most of the fishing within reach of the bank.

General rules of thumb for this kind of water
- Brown, humic water dampens the light — fishing can be good even in the middle of the day.
